A little more about your role:

  • Meeting the requirements of a 'Senior Engineer' grade and have a proven track record in both leading projects for your discipline and for an overall project team.
  • Be able to demonstrate where your personal input has led to the commission being won or successfully delivered.
  • Able to work using initiative with minimal supervision on all technical aspects of their discipline or have specific specialist experience applicable to the role.
  • Able to work under the clear direction of the client and interpret the needs of the project as a whole to meet the full delivery needs.
  • Work in a joint leadership capacity within a mechanical, electrical and public health (MEP) discipline team providing design and technical advice in a project manager capacity on a wide range of projects.
  • Supervise the completion of detailed designs and supervise the work of others in this function.
  • Consider the feasibility of the project specific to the discipline and lead the overall feasibility study for the project.
  • Take responsibility for and direct others in the production of detailed and performance specification for the discipline subject to review by colleagues prior to issue.
  • Regularly brief the project team, including explaining the appointment.
  • Reviewing design programmes and ensuring that sufficient resource is available to complete the works.

Your Team:

  • Our team is comprised of 35 engineers working across the Mechanical, Electrical and Public Health specialisms.
  • Our team is based in the Cambridge office.
  • As part of our team, you would be working on some of our major projects including Gatwick and Heathrow Airports, Royal Berkshire Hospital and several public and private sector client sites.
  • You will be reporting to our Technical Director for Mechanical engineering.
  • You will be able to utilise graduate, assistant, senior and principal engineers in supporting roles around you, as well as dedicated BIM and Sustainability specialists to contribute to your projects.

What we will be looking for you to demonstrate:

  • Working towards Chartership via an Engineering Council accredited honours degree or specific experience.
  • Degree in Building services Engineering or applicable discipline, or relevant equivalent experience.
  • Working towards IET Engineer or Chartered Building Services Engineer.

Key Technical Requirements:

  • Have a detailed understanding of the regulations applicable to the discipline and how to demonstrate this through calculation.
  • Have working understanding of latest electrical design software packages to allow the allocation/direction of work on projects.
  • Have an ability to sketch and communicate technical detail graphically and effectively.
  • Have the ability to engage with clients and contractors in technical discussions and debates.
  • Have understanding of working with RevitMEP or other 3D design software to allow the allocation/direction of work on projects.
  • Must be able to obtain UK vetting level of Security Check (SC).

Electrical Design Skills:

  • Low voltage distribution systems.
  • Low voltage standby generation.
  • UPS systems.
  • Cable calculations (via software and by hand).
  • Lighting calculations (via software and by hand).
  • Small power.
  • Fire alarms.
  • Intruder detection.
  • Access control & security systems.
  • Disabled call systems.
  • Data cabling and outlets.
  • Lightning protection.
